In the fourth quarter of FY26, Naga Dhunseri Group Ltd reported a total income of ₹73.12 crores. This represents a significant decline of 47.9% quarter-over-quarter (QoQ) from ₹140.38 crores in Q3FY26. However, when compared year-over-year (YoY) to Q4FY25, where the total income was ₹56.76 crores, there is an increase of 28.8%. The fluctuations in total income over these periods highlight the volatility or possible seasonality in the revenue generation of the company.

The company recorded a profit before tax of -₹37.33 crores for Q4FY26, which is a deterioration from -₹11.98 crores in Q3FY26, marking an increase in pre-tax losses by 211.6% QoQ. Compared to Q4FY25, where the profit before tax was -₹11.28 crores, there is a 230.9% increase in losses YoY. The profit after tax for Q4FY26 stood at -₹40.53 crores, worsening from -₹11.16 crores in Q3FY26, a change of 263.2% QoQ. The YoY change from Q4FY25 where the profit after tax was -₹12.63 crores is 220.9%. These figures underscore a challenging period in terms of profitability for the company.

The total expenses for Q4FY26 were ₹114.79 crores, showing a decrease of 24.7% from the previous quarter’s expenses of ₹152.35 crores. However, there was a substantial increase of 106.9% in expenses YoY from ₹55.47 crores in Q4FY25. This significant rise in expenses compared to the previous year may have impacted the company's profitability. The earnings per share (EPS) for Q4FY26 was reported at -₹267.50, which reflects a decline from -₹79.30 in Q3FY26, rising by 237.3% QoQ. Compared to Q4FY25, where EPS was -₹126.33, there is an increase of 111.7% YoY.
